Expensive?

I wasn't familiar with the current situation until last year when my adult daughter decided to buy a road bike. What I found is that it's actually cheaper and easier to go to a local bike shop and buy clipless pedals than it is to even find a good quality ordinary pedal (other than cheap mountain bike pedals). Good so-called platform pedals are more of an internet-based item, and by the time you get a pair home, they aren't that cheap.

Of course, with clipless, the shoes do add to the cost, but then, once you have them, you do end up with better shoes for cycling than civilians shoes.
